Oh...on the drill front - DON'T let it get smoking hot, give it rest every few seconds (spinning
in air is fine) and lubricate it!!! Liquid Wrench works fine for this (in your environment).  

Also, invest in a Drill Doctor (I recommend this to everyone on the list).  Obtain a set of good
grade uncoated HSS (high-speed steel) drills.

> > Drilling the rivets can be a PITA without a drill press...using one?
> >
> > In any case, choose a drill that's pretty big - I use a 1/2" - and drill
> > until the head of the
> > rivet comes off.  No farther.  After you get all the heads off, support
> > the diff on 2x4s sideways,
> > and use a heavy hammer and punch to drive them out of the diff.  If you
> > are going to use the same
> > diff and ring gear, put the bolts in before all the rivets are drilled out
> > so you avoid separating
> > the ring and the diff.
> >
> > This is a 15-20 min job once you know how to do it and have the right
> > tools.
